Abstract

1453366 Welding by fusion VSES NI PROEKTNO-KONSTRUKT I TEKHNOL INST ELEKTROSVAROCH OBORUDOVANIA 9 May 1974 20609/74 Heading B3R [Also in Divisions H3-H5] A non-consumable plasma torch electrode assembly comprises a water cooled rod like electrically conductive copper holder 1, containing a refractory metal insert 2 at one end, a chamber 3 symmetrical about the longitudinal axis of the assembly being provided in the holder 1 and being bounded on one side by a central portion only of the insert 2, the chamber being filled with a substance of lower thermal conductivity than the material of the holder 1 so that the central portion of the insert 2 is cooled less than the peripheral portion which is in direct contact with the holder 1. Thus in use the arc is centred on the hotter central zone of the insert 32 and does not tend to migrate to the cooler peripheral zone. The refractory metal of the insert may be a refractory metal of groups IV, V and VI, or an alloy of these metals. Specified alloys are Ta 73%/Hf 25%/Mo 2% : Hf 99%/ Mo 1% : W 97%/La 3%. The material filling the chamber 3 may be titanium, steel, pig iron, air or argon. The plasma torch may be a d.c. transferred arc torch in which the electrode assembly is supported in a hollow water cooled nozzle by an insulating spacer provided with longitudinal channels for introduction of plasma forming gas to the end of the electrode assembly. In Fig. 4 (not shown) two plasma torches with electrode assemblies as described connected in series are supplied from a d.c. source to produce a heated plasma for surfacing an adjacent workpiece. The electrode assembly if connected to the positive pole has a gas filled chamber behind the insert and the electrode assembly connected to the negative pole has a solid filled chamber. The torch can be used for welding, surfacing, surface finishing and cutting metals.
